Originally Posted by geeteezee
Is it wrong that I'm not wowed? 8 liter engine makes a lot of power. In other news, the sky is blue. lul
+1 big engine big horsepower is impressive and not really impressive. HP per litre is not that high overall. A GTR has a better ratio to put it mildly??